摘要

We theoretically explore the mechanism in a thulium Q-switched ytterbium-doped all-fiber fiber laser using a set of rate equations to model the correlations between the photons and the five energy levels of thulium involved in the Q switching mechanism. We demonstrate that by coupling with a gain-switched resonator, the Q-switched laser is stabilized up to the maximum pulsing rate that is limited by the lifetime of level H-3(5). To the best of our knowledge, this is the first study that revealed that level H-3(5) plays an essential role in reinitialization, achieving sequential pulses, and limiting the maximum repetition rate.
